3645040 | 人工智慧晶片設計與應用 | AI-on-Chip | 3.0 | 3 |
中文概述 Chinese Description | 這門課程深入探討將AI技術直接整合至硬體的過程。課程從AI晶片的基本概念開始,進一步探討各種AI的數位、類比及混合訊號架構。課程內容涵蓋了對神經網路模型映射到晶片硬體的過程及優化。重要的一環是神經網路編譯器的設計與優化,並輔以實務工具和考量以實現高效的AI晶片設計。課程還探討了AI晶片的當前應用及AI硬體發展的未來趨勢。課程以學生專題為導向,將所學知識應用於創新的AI晶片解決方案。此課程旨在為學生提供在不斷進化的AI硬體領域中取得成功所需的技能和知識。 | |||
英文概述 English Description | This course, titled "AI-on-Chip Design: Architectures and Applications," offers a deep dive into how AI technologies are integrated directly onto hardware. It begins with fundamental concepts of AI-on-Chip, moving into the intricacies of digital, analog, and mixed-signal architectures tailored for AI applications. The curriculum includes a thorough examination of neural network models, focusing on their optimization and the critical process of mapping these models onto hardware. A significant portion is dedicated to the design and optimization of neural network compilers, supplemented by practical insights into the tools and considerations necessary for efficient AI chip design. The course also explores current applications of AI-on-Chip and anticipates future trends that could reshape AI hardware development.
